Title
Shiffler Fire Company Belt
Description
Firefighter's belt from the Shiffler Fire Company. 2.5in wide leather belt painted dark red, edges bound in green leather with a scalloped edge on the front. Center cut out portion reveals a green background with raised metal letters: "SHIFFLER." A silver colored metal buckle (3in) displays in relief fire fighting equipment. A sheild in the center contains a #7. The bent edge on the back of the shield hookos over a link at the pposite end of the belt. Belt size is adjusted by moving hooks (attached at both ends of belt) to various holes in the belt.
Note: A card, found loose in the box near this belt reads: "Shiffler Fire Co., No 7, Leather Belt. Presented by Mrs. Elizabeth Morrison, Bausman, PA."

Collection
Firefighting Collection
Description
Union Fire Company parade Helmet from 1867, front badge, shield-shaped rear brim; made by Cairns and Bros., New York City. Leather exterior painted black overall. Brim painted green on underside. Center front, a gold metal emblem with firefighting equipment and a raised silver metal #1. Golden metal buttons with "FD" above each ear, with gold rope (with 2 square note) looped over them. Unpainted leather lining with 2.625in fabric band at base. "CF May" written in ink onto fabric band. "union: painted in gold letters on rear brim.

Title
Farmer's Bank Fire Bucket
Description
Leather fire bucket . Painted black banner with yellow letters: "Farmer's Bank." has foliate designs on both ends of banner. "No. 9" is painted below banner in black. Stitched leather construction. Metal D rings and leather loops attach 1in wide leather handle and bucket. Tag found inside bucket: "Water Bucket of C W Richenbach Property of Union No 1". Tag is for 1931 Union Fire Company annual dinner. Tag is now in object file.
